I have put together the following Novice station:
DX-60A
HG-10B
HR-10B
Hallicrafters SX-99
D-104 Silver Eagle amplified mic.
Lionel J-38 hand key.
http://n8ie.com/aboutus.aspx

The DX-60A was re-capped and brought back from the dead. (lots of issues)
The HG-10B was re-tubed.
I'm waiting on a re-cap kit from Hayseed Hamfest for the HR-10B, I have re-tubed it.

I'm on either 40M CW or 80M AM most nights.
